The Volumetric Display Market is gaining attention as enterprises and technology developers explore glass-free three-dimensional visualization that can be viewed from different angles. Unlike conventional two-dimensional screens, volumetric systems generate images with depth within a physical or perceived volume, allowing users to examine objects and spatial information more naturally. Industry Growth Driven by Demand for Immersive Visualization
One of the strongest factors supporting growth is the increasing need to understand complex three-dimensional information quickly. In healthcare, volumetric visualization can support the interpretation of anatomical structures and improve the presentation of medical images. In aerospace and defense, the technology can help users interact with terrain, mission information, simulations, and other spatial data.
Automotive manufacturers are also exploring advanced visualization for design, human-machine interfaces, simulation, and next-generation vehicle experiences. Meanwhile, media and entertainment companies are investigating three-dimensional displays for exhibitions, events, gaming, advertising, and immersive experiences.
The technology is evolving through innovations in swept-volume, static-volume, and multi-planar approaches, while improvements in projectors, motors, position sensors, mirrors, processors, and rendering software are helping manufacturers address performance and usability challenges. Latest Industry Developments and Trends
Recent industry analysis shows that volumetric visualization is increasingly being connected with real-time graphics, spatial computing, and AI-enabled content workflows. Falling component costs and improvements in processing capabilities are helping developers explore more commercially viable systems.
At the same time, the competitive landscape is becoming more technology-driven. Companies are working to improve brightness, resolution, viewing angles, system size, image quality, processing speed, and ease of content creation. Industry research also identifies increasing attention toward rendering software and GPU capabilities, indicating that software innovation is becoming an important source of differentiation.
The broader technology ecosystem is also benefiting from developments in medical imaging, defense visualization, automotive interfaces, and immersive entertainment. However, challenges remain, including high development costs, complex content creation, limitations in resolution, system integration requirements, and the need for specialized expertise.
